December Is Not Dead: Why This Month Is the Secret Microschool Enrollment Window

Maybe you've already launched your microschool. You've done the hard work. You've enrolled your first students. You've created the space. You've built the systems. And now you're looking at your roster thinking… "Okay… but how do I get more students for second semester? And how do I do it when it feels like no one is paying attention right now?" Maybe your social posts are getting quiet. Maybe your email list is collecting dust because you don't even know what to write. Maybe you feel like you used up all your excitement in your very first Founding Tribe Launch… and now you're in that weird in-between season where you're doing everything yourself and trying to market consistently and it just feels like you're shouting into the holiday void. Most teachers think December is a dead month for marketing; but that's because they've never been taught how the family decision cycle actually works. December is NOT dead. December is a decision season. January is one of the BIGGEST enrollment windows of the entire year. What you need is a strategic re-launch plan for big enrollment seasons not just the first time you ever launched your microschool, but every time you need to invite new families in. And that's exactly what I'm going to walk you through in this episode. Let's talk about the power of a December re-launch.
